The Amount Of Tarot Cards remain in a Basic Deck?
A standard tarot deck contains 78 cards, split right into two major groups: the Major Arcana and the Minor Arcana. The Major Arcana is included 22 cards, while the Minor Arcana includes 56 cards.
The Major Arcana cards are commonly seen as the most substantial and powerful cards in the deck. Each card in the Major Arcana represents an universal theme or archetype, such as The Fool, The Illusionist, The High Priestess, and The Lovers. These cards are usually related to significant life occasions and spiritual development.
The Minor Arcana cards, on the other hand, are split right into four fits: Wands, Cups, Swords, and Pentacles. Each match has 14 cards, including 10 numbered cards and 4 face card (Web page, Knight, Queen, King). The Minor Arcana cards are frequently connected with daily events, emotions, and experiences.
- The Fit of Wands: Stands for imagination, energy, and action.
- The Match of Cups: Stands for emotions, relationships, and instinct.
- The Match of Swords: Represents ideas, obstacles, and interaction.
- The Match of Pentacles: Represents worldly riches, security, and abundance.
The Value of Each Tarot Card
Each tarot card in a deck holds its own unique significance and meaning. Tarot readers analyze the cards based upon their individual intuition, understanding of the traditional significances, and the context of the spiritual readings reading. Right here are a couple of instances of the importance of some crucial tarot cards:
The Fool: Represents new beginnings, virtue, and spontaneity. It indicates taking a jump of faith and embracing the unknown.
The High Priestess: Represents instinct, enigma, and the subconscious mind. It indicates the requirement for self-contemplation and trusting one’s internal wisdom.
The Tower: Represents sudden modification, turmoil, and change. It signifies the malfunction of old frameworks to give way for new development and understanding.
